Our client, a public accounting firm, is currently seeking a Senior Associate, Tax to join their team as the organization continues to grow. Reporting into the Director, the incumbent will be responsible for eligibility determination, member escalation inquiries, manual data transfers to vendors, government filings, and preparation for financial statement audits (annual and quarterly).

Key Responsibilities:

  • Participate in tax consulting engagements including corporate reorganizations, estate freezes, estate litigation and other general tax planning.
  • Research and analyze technical tax topics.
  • Prepare tax models to illustrate the potential tax savings from proposed tax plan.
  • Prepare and review tax compliance and election forms arising out of tax planning engagements.
  • Assist in reviewing legal documents from tax perspective to implement proposed reorganization.
  • Prepare special forms such as applications for the Voluntary Disclosure Program and request for a clearance certificate.
  • Provide training and support service to the compliance department on tax related topics.
  • Present research finding by either verbal or written communication in a professional manner.
  • Liaise with Canada Revenue Agency and relevant provincial ministries on client issues.
  • Assist in writing bi-weekly tax articles for internal and external use.
  • Enter daily timesheet and expenses in CCH.
  • Meet billable target hours.
  • Work closely with other departments to assist clients with varies professional services need.
  • Perform other duties as assigned.

Requirements:

  • Certified Public Accounting (CPA) designation.
  • Completed or close to completion of CPA Canada In-Depth Tax Course. (Asset)
  • 2+ years’ working experience in public accounting practice with a specialization in tax, preparing and reviewing personal, corporate and trust returns, estate tax planning, corporate reorganizations, and dispute resolution.
  • Demonstrated understanding of increasingly complex tax concepts and effective application of tax knowledge to client situations.
  • Proficient in the use of CCH (Tax Prep), CaseWare, MS Office Microsoft Word, Excel and PowerPoint.
  • Demonstrated excellence in oral and written communication skills.
  • Proven strong project management and organizational skills.
